New research, by cervical cancer charity Jo’s Cervical Cancer Trust, has found that women with physical disabilities are facing barriers to accessing life-saving cervical screening. Their survey of 335 women living with physical disabilities found that 63% had been unable to attend a screening due to their disability ...
